Frequently asked questions

 

1) What options are available for food at your site?

We have a kitchen down at the reception/campground that has a commercial convection oven, two griddles, two large bbq's with side burners, a sink, two fridges, pots, and an assortment of chaffing dishes, salad bowls, ect.


2) Can we bring our own caterer?

Yes, you can bring your own caterer or just get the family together and do your own food.

 

3) What kitchen facilities are available for the caterer?

The caterer is welcome to use the kitchen which is included in the wedding package.

 

4) Are there any caterers you recommend?

Yes, there are a number of local companies that do a great job, just ask for a list. 

6) What is the set-up for camping?

Our property is 21 acres, so lots of room for RV's and tents. We do not have hook ups, but we do have running water, electricity and one outdoor shower. Guests can camp in the main area or go into the trees if they want privacy. Rv's can be rented at Island Rv 250-756-1626 for the weekend and are delivered, set up and picked up for about $200. per unit. The units are new, clean and sleep 6 or more.

8) Is there a quiet hour?

At 11:00 we ask that the amplified music is turned down and at 12:00 it is turned off. You are welcome to switch to a non-amplified system at this time such as an ipod dock or computer. You can also have a band, and they can play until 11:00

 

9) Can the sound system be used for the reception and dance or do we need to hire someone with a professional sound system?

We can move the microphone and speakers down to the reception hall for speeches. Our system is not available for music at this time.

I do have a system that can be used for the ceremony music which I can operate if you provide your music on a CD.

You can hire a DJ for about $500. I have some that I can recommend, or alot of people just use a computer or Ipod and make their own playlists in advance.

 

10) Do we need to rent plates, cutlery, glasses? 
Special Occasions Party Rentals are very reasonable for these items. For example, 100 plates are only $35. and they drop off, pick up and wash them for this price. They can be reached at 250-746-7611.

12) Are dogs allowed on the property?

Yes, dogs are welcome at the campground as long as they are under control and not chasing horses or disturbing other guests.

 

13) Can the Weekend Wedding package be extended?

Yes, extra nights can be added to the wedding package in the guest house for $150. per night. Guests are welcome to stay one extra night at the campground for $25 per person.

 

14) What options are there for serving alcohol? Can we bring our own? Do we need a liquor license? 
You can bring your own store bought alcohol, what you need is a $25. liquor license and a bartender with a "serving it right" ticket. The serving it right course is available online for $40. at www.servingitright.com Serving of alcohol must be consistent with current B.C. regulations.

 

15) Do I need to purchase Insurance for my wedding?

The Special Event Insurance is included in our Wedding package. We purchase a PAL insurance policy in your name and handle all the details. All we need from you is a Liquor Licence one week before your wedding and we handle the purchasing of the policy from there.
